If the sentence below is correct, may I use "done" and "finished" interchangeably?

1) When you're DONE / FINISHED with the paper, throw in/into the bin.

By the way, should I use "in" or "into"?

Both are more or less correct, although you would say "throw it in the bin". Done is more common in US English, finished in British English.
